
In today's world, education is under great pressure, which can lead to children being overwhelmed.
Holidays should be a time for rest and exploration, not for exhausting learning. Let's teach children that boredom can be a source of ideas and creativity. Engaging them in projects that promote collaboration and teamwork will teach them how important it is to share ideas and inspire each other. In this way, children not only learn but also build important social skills.
